Output 794157740536b0743fed35fbddcc5bb51b0e738c88b643f7c2b0cfd816bf862a:83

value
74496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c027d9a99f9519c772d2e6161748c9b91a9d5f96 OP_EQUAL
address
3KD3QDe3AZ5PKbLLjDUXBaSjac9mvhUnaD
transaction
794157740536b0743fed35fbddcc5bb51b0e738c88b643f7c2b0cfd816bf862a
confirmations
248108
spent
true